Output 22f803a91961332d98f19fb4d1fd51418c25b5009564e49d6d85697375719c3e:1

value
2435425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2fd366f1d14405df432229fcbcb7be8eeba4e9 OP_EQUAL
address
3MfyCYnBXiaNVWifLsVEyCBX9mGfEhSGgU
transaction
22f803a91961332d98f19fb4d1fd51418c25b5009564e49d6d85697375719c3e
spent
true